The palace was so beautiful and the experience of going to the market to select your picnic items and then have a picnic in front of the palace was unforgettable! The tour guide was very professional and was very nice and really made the tour enjoyable. One thing to note, when you go to the Palace you must visit the Palace first before the gardens because they will not let you in to the Palace after the gardens without waiting in line again. We made this mistake because it looked like it was going to rain and we went to the gardens first and were not able to get in the Palace. The actual time for the Palace and garden tour is too short and I would have loved to spend more time there but the tour was still totally worth every penny and more!
